CT's Finest Auto Club, First Annual Car Show, August 29th, 2010


Sunday August 29th, saw us at CT's Finest Auto Club First Annual Car Show at the Porter & Chester site in Enfield. On a blisteringly hot day, almost 200 cars and bikes turned out for the event. Many of Connecticut's car clubs had representatives at the show, including Dreamz II Reality (DIIR), Street Terminators, Game Over, High Life Creationz, and Frontline Auto Club. Cruisin' would like to give a big thank you to the guys from DIIR for housing Kathy and me under their complex of gazebos, which offered some welcome shade from the hot August sunshine.

Some fabulous cars and bikes were in attendance, with one of the standouts being Lew Lombardo’s blown Camaro convertible. What a beautiful car it is.

Plenty of awards were up for grabs at the end of the day. DIIR was prominent at awards time. They took the ‘Best Club' trophy, Gary Lambert took 'Best Bike' with his superb Suzuki Hayabusa, John Crowley took 'Best Lexus', Jeff Alexander was awarded 'Best Scion', Pedro took 'Best Nissan' and Jerry took 'Best Chopper'. The club also took a host of second and third places as well. The awards were not the sole property of DIIR as the team from Game Over also featured highly. CT's Finest Auto Club laid on a great event. Let's hope they choose a cooler day for it next year!
